Synopsis 3 Day Potty Training by : Lora Jensen

3 Day Potty Training is a fun and easy-to-follow guide for potty training even the most stubborn child just 3 days. Not just for pee and poop but for day and night too! Lora’s method is all about training the child to learn their own body signs. If the parent is having to do all the work, then the child isn’t truly trained, but with Lora’s method your child will learn when their body is telling them that they need to use the potty and they will communicate that need to you.

Synopsis Oh Crap! Potty Training by : Jamie Glowacki

From potty-training expert and social worker Jamie Glowacki, who’s already helped over half a million families successfully toilet train their preschoolers, comes a newly revised and updated guide that’s “straight-up, parent-tested, and funny to boot” (Amber Dusick, author of Parenting: Illustrated with Crappy Pictures). Worried about potty training? Let Jamie Glowacki, potty-training expert, show you how it’s done. Her six-step, proven process to get your toddler out of diapers and onto the toilet has already worked for tens of thousands of kids and their parents. Here’s the good news: your child is probably ready to be potty trained EARLIER than you think (ideally, between 20–30 months), and it can be done FASTER than you expect (most kids get the basics in a few days—but Jamie’s got you covered even if it takes a little longer). If you’ve ever said to yourself: -How do I know if my kid is ready? -Why won’t my child poop in the potty? -How do I avoid “potty power struggles”? -How can I get their daycare provider on board? -My kid was doing so well—why is he regressing? -And what about nighttime?! Oh Crap! Potty Training can solve all of these (and other) common issues. This isn’t theory, you’re not bribing with candy, and there are no gimmicks. This is real-world, from-the-trenches potty training information—all the questions and all the answers you need to do it once and be done with diapers for good.

Synopsis The First-Time Mom's Potty-Training Handbook by : Megan Pierson M.A.

Ditch diapers for good with this new mom's guide to potty training Potty training is a big step for both the parent and the child. How long should it take? When's the best time to start? The process comes with plenty of questions and worries, but this handbook is here to walk first-time moms through it. The simple format lays out exactly what to do every step of the way, with expert advice to inspire, encourage, and equip any new mom with the tools for success. Timing is everything—Learn how to read the readiness signs and start potty training at the right time. Getting started—Find out how to talk to toddlers about potty training so they know what to expect, and find tips for stocking up on everything from extra underwear to small rewards. Fact or fiction?—Bust some common myths about potty training and find a full Q&A section to help with a range of possible obstacles. Make potty training as painless as possible with The First-Time Mom's Potty Training Handbook.

Synopsis I Go Potty, Mommy by : Tiffany Harris

n the heartwarming third book of the "Jordy Bear's Big Boy Adventures" series, our lovable little Jordy Bear is taking a big step towards independence-learning to go potty all by himself!Jordy Bear has been growing up so fast and is excited about this new adventure. With a bright smile on his face, he begins his journey into the world of potty training. Throughout the book, young readers will follow Jordy as he discovers the importance of recognizing when it's time to go potty.As he navigates this new chapter of his life, Jordy experiences a mix of triumphs and challenges. He learns to listen to his body and follow his instincts, but one day, things don't go as planned. Jordy Bear has an accident, and he feels a bit embarrassed. This relatable moment brings out the true essence of the story-empathy, understanding, and the unconditional love of a parent.Jordy Bear's mommy is always there for him, providing gentle guidance and reassurance. She helps him understand that accidents happen and that making mistakes while learning is okay. Through her patience and support, Jordy Bear learns that it's all part of the process and that he's still progressing on his big-boy journey.The heartwarming conclusion of "I Go Potty, Mommy" shows Jordy Bear gaining confidence again. With his mommy's loving guidance and determination to learn, Jordy masters the art of going potty by himself."I Go Potty, Mommy" is a delightful and relatable story that beautifully captures the joys and challenges of growing up. Through Jordy Bear's experiences, young readers will learn about the importance of patience, perseverance, and the power of unconditional love. This book is a must-read for parents and children navigating the exciting potty training journey together.
